Product Descriptions
Each of these monolithic circuits contains eight master-slave flip-flops and additional gating to implement. two individual four-bit counters in a single package. The '390 and 'LS390 incorporate dual divide-by-two and divide-by-five counters, which can be used to implement cycle lengths equal to any whole and/or cumulative multiples of 2 and/or 5 up to divide-by-100. When connected as a bi-quinarycounter, the separate divide-by-two circuit can be used to provide symmetry (a square wave) at the final output stage.
Product Features
Dual Versions of the Popular '90A, 'LS90 and '93A, 'LS93
'390, 'LS390 .. Individual Clocks for A and B Flip-Flops Provide Dual ÷ 2 and ÷ 5 Counters
'393, 'LS393... Dual 4-Bit Binary Counter with Individual Clocks
All Have Direct Clear for Each 4-Bit Counter
Dual 4-Bit Versions Can Significantly Improve System Densities by Reducing Counter Package Count by 50 percent
Typical Maximum Count Frequency ... 35 MHz
Buffered Outputs Reduce Possibility of Collector Commutation
